Exclusive Video Interview: Ben Kingsley And Patricia Clarkson Talk Learning To Drive

Opening in theaters on August 21st is the new comedic drama from director Isabel Coixet, Learning to Drive. The film stars Academy Award-nominee Patricia Clarkson as Wendy, a Manhattan writer in the process of a divorce.

Needing to drive for the first time in her life, she takes lessons from a Sikh instructor named Darwan (Academy Award-winner Sir Ben Kingsley), who has marriage troubles of his own. While in each other’s company, they find the courage to get back on the road and the strength to take the wheel.

Recently, at the LA press day for Learning to Drive, we sat down with Kingsley and Clarkson for an exclusive interview about their new film. They spoke about working together once again, how intimacy is portrayed on screen, how they find their character and more.
